Step 1: Understanding HGB Certificates

  • Definition: HGB (Hak Guna Bangunan) refers to a land use right certificate in Indonesia that allows the holder to build on land owned by the state for a specified period.
  • Importance: Recognizing the role of HGB certificates in land ownership and development is crucial, especially in urban planning and investment.
